Chun Shek ( Chinese: 秦石) is a small hill (c.70m) capped by boulders in Tai Wai, Sha Tin District, Hong Kong.
The hill is located next to the Che Kung Temple and is possibly the origin of the name of the nearby Chun Shek Estate. The hill does not seem to have an official name, although the name Chun Shek (秦石) is mentioned by several sources.
